Say Goodbye to Hard Water Headaches: Choosing the Right Water Softener System
Ditch those pesky hard water woes with a water softener system tailored to your needs. Identifying the right type can feel overwhelming, though with a bit of research and consideration of your household's demands, you'll be well on your way to softer, cleaner water.
First, assess the level of your hard water situation. If you're dealing with persistent soap scum buildup or noticeable mineral deposits on your fixtures, it's a good sign that a softener is required.
- There are two main types of water softeners: standard and salt-free. Conventional systems use ion exchange to replace the hard minerals with sodium ions, while salt-free options employ alternative methods like template-assisted crystallization or magnetic water conditioning.
- Choose the suitable capacity for your household size and water usage.
Consult a water treatment professional for personalized advice based on your specific needs and budget.

Water Softener Maintenance Made Easy: Keep Your System Running Smoothly
Maintaining your water softener doesn't have to be a complex task. By following these simple steps, you can keep your system running optimally. Regular checkups are crucial for ensuring that your softener continues to remove calcium and magnesium from your water.
- Examine the salt level in the brine tank regularly and top off as needed.
- Clean the resin bed according to the manufacturer's guidelines.
- Monitor for any leaks or signs of damage, and address them promptly.
- Analyze your water hardness levels periodically to ensure that the softener is functioning properly.
By dedicating a little time to maintenance, you can prolong the life of your water softener and enjoy soft, clean water for years to come.
